π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Cut lid in bread and hollow out.

Saute onion in margarine until tender, but not brown.

Stir in corn, potato, bell pepper, half and half, chicken broth, salt and pepper.

Simmer 15 minutes. Ladle soup into bread "bowls" and garnish with parsley.
